fall inverb
- 1
To collapse inwards.
- The heavy rain caused the roof to fall in.

- 4
To come to an end; to terminate; to lapse.
- On the death of Mr. B., the annuity, which he had so long received, fell in.
- 5
To become operative.
- The reversion, to which he had been nominated twenty years before, fell in.
